IPv6-Lab

Initial situation

In this project, a laboratory for IPv6 will be set up using a desktop computer with a current Debian system. To use the computer furthermore for its actual purpose, this should be done as far as possible without stirring up a lot of dust (e.g. using various outdated network backends).

OS: Debian GNU/Linux 12
Kernel: 6.1.0-18-amd64
Network backend: NetworkManager
Hypervisor: KVM
Virtual switch: Open vSwitch 3.1.0

Required packages

  • openvswitch-switch
  • gvncviewer

Configuring Systems

Bridge br0

The bridge is part of the host system. Thus, it is configured using the network manager command line tool. These settings will be permanent.

Info about current connetions

# nmcli con show

Add bridge

# nmcli con add type bridge ifname labBridge0

Add interface to the bridge

# nmcli con add type bridge-slave ifname wlp4s0 master labBridge0

Turn on the bridge

# nmcli con up bridge-labBridge0

Hypervisor

KVM is used as a hypervisor in this project. You may use virsh on the cli or virt-manager as a graphical tool.

Create virtual network on hypervisor

Here we create a new network to be used by the edge router torino by creating a new file named bridged-network.xml with the following content

<network>
    <name>bridged-network</name>
    <forward mode="bridge" />
    <bridge name="br0" />
</network>

To create the network on the hypervisor, run

$ virsh net-define bridged-network.xml

Then start it

$ virsh net-start bridged-network 
$ virsh net-autostart bridged-network 
$ virsh net-list
 Name              Status   Automatischer Start   Bleibend
------------------------------------------------------------
 bridged-network   Aktiv    ja                    ja##

Torino

Torino is the WAN router of the lab. On the external interface torino acts as a DHCPv6 client in order to receive a Prefix Delegation from the DSL-Router (Fritz!Box in this case). On the internal interface torino will serve Router Advertisements which is necessary for SLAAC. The hosts in the lab environment connectetd to the vSwitch will receive a prefix via SLAAC this way.

DHCP Client

The dhcpcd package has to be installed on the OpenBSD system.

# pkg_add dhcpcd
# rcctl enable dhcpcd

Edit the config file /etc/dhcpcd.conf

ipv6only
noipv6rs

script ""

allowinterfaces vio0 re0
interface vio0
  ipv6rs
  ia_pd 1 re0/1
